summ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Daniel Robbins <drobbins@gentoo.org>2000-11-22 21:25:18 +0000
committerDaniel Robbins <drobbins@gentoo.org>2000-11-22 21:25:18 +0000
commite53b113e3f03cddaec9cca5fecc629106879b685 (patch)
treebfc91e075922a75d10e431fbc6b73f33ebd7e037
parentrc-update fix and new webtools (diff)
downloadhistorical-e53b113e3f03cddaec9cca5fecc629106879b685.tar.gz
historical-e53b113e3f03cddaec9cca5fecc629106879b685.tar.bz2
historical-e53b113e3f03cddaec9cca5fecc629106879b685.zip
kernel updates
-rw-r--r--sys-kernel/linux-sources/files/2.4.0_rc10/linux-sources-2.4.0_rc10.autoconf (renamed from sys-kernel/linux-sources/files/linux-sources-2.4.10_rc10.autoconf)0
-rw-r--r--sys-kernel/linux-sources/files/2.4.0_rc10/linux-sources-2.4.0_rc10.config (renamed from sys-kernel/linux-sources/files/linux-sources-2.4.10_rc10.config)0
-rw-r--r--sys-kernel/linux-sources/files/digest-linux-sources-2.4.10_rc109
-rw-r--r--sys-kernel/linux-sources/linux-sources-2.4.0_rc10-r1.ebuild (renamed from sys-kernel/linux-sources/linux-sources-2.4.10_rc10.ebuild)13
-rw-r--r--sys-kernel/linux/files/2.4.0_rc10/linux-2.4.0_rc10.autoconf (renamed from sys-kernel/linux/files/linux-2.4.10_rc10.autoconf)0
-rw-r--r--sys-kernel/linux/files/2.4.0_rc10/linux-2.4.0_rc10.config (renamed from sys-kernel/linux/files/linux-2.4.10_rc10.config)0
-rw-r--r--sys-kernel/linux/files/digest-linux-2.4.10_rc109
-rw-r--r--sys-kernel/linux/linux-2.4.0_rc10-r1.ebuild (renamed from sys-kernel/linux/linux-2.4.10_rc10.ebuild)13
8 files changed, 20 insertions, 24 deletions
diff --git a/sys-kernel/linux-sources/files/linux-sources-2.4.10_rc10.autoconf b/sys-kernel/linux-sources/files/2.4.0_rc10/linux-sources-2.4.0_rc10.autoconf
index a93b70337b72..a93b70337b72 100644
--- a/sys-kernel/linux-sources/files/linux-sources-2.4.10_rc10.autoconf
+++ b/sys-kernel/linux-sources/files/2.4.0_rc10/linux-sources-2.4.0_rc10.autoconf
diff --git a/sys-kernel/linux-sources/files/linux-sources-2.4.10_rc10.config b/sys-kernel/linux-sources/files/2.4.0_rc10/linux-sources-2.4.0_rc10.config
index f4fbf51382c8..f4fbf51382c8 100644
--- a/sys-kernel/linux-sources/files/linux-sources-2.4.10_rc10.config
+++ b/sys-kernel/linux-sources/files/2.4.0_rc10/linux-sources-2.4.0_rc10.config
diff --git a/sys-kernel/linux-sources/files/digest-linux-sources-2.4.10_rc10 b/sys-kernel/linux-sources/files/digest-linux-sources-2.4.10_rc10
deleted file mode 100644
index 0ada5ec263a1..000000000000
--- a/sys-kernel/linux-sources/files/digest-linux-sources-2.4.10_rc10
+++ /dev/null
@@ -1,9 +0,0 @@
-MD5 8f281617879cf79c44561fb8fb90caec linux-2.4.0-test8.tar.bz2
-MD5 33f1208d6b07e42937de92b0be14fc99 linux-2.4.0-test9-reiserfs-3.6.18-patch.gz
-MD5 3878cd9f9f9e45bddb625dd4059e7e32 patch-2.4.0-test9.bz2
-MD5 3fb3759c30a51bf230a231815413d433 patch-2.4.0-test10.bz2
-MD5 039fb223e361d343e8d40c54f0a317e6 i2c-2.5.4.tar.gz
-MD5 c16f3df6b5f9e56b146071edfa5ec5d4 lm_sensors-2.5.4.tar.gz
-MD5 b2cf95e1189e63b44e6f7ae7fc27ae19 jfs-0.0.18-patch.tar.gz
-MD5 5d4983ad745464954aa770196167ad06 alsa-driver-0.5.9d.tar.bz2
-MD5 130d1e7bf56eda1a93a831189b4c6420 NVIDIA_kernel-0.9-5.tar.gz
diff --git a/sys-kernel/linux-sources/linux-sources-2.4.10_rc10.ebuild b/sys-kernel/linux-sources/linux-sources-2.4.0_rc10-r1.ebuild
index 3e0288f73300..a2fa164be4e4 100644
--- a/sys-kernel/linux-sources/linux-sources-2.4.10_rc10.ebuild
+++ b/sys-kernel/linux-sources/linux-sources-2.4.0_rc10-r1.ebuild
@@ -1,7 +1,7 @@
# Copyright 1999-2000 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License, v2 or later
# Author Daniel Robbins <drobbins@gentoo.org>
-# $Header: /var/cvsroot/gentoo-x86/sys-kernel/linux-sources/linux-sources-2.4.10_rc10.ebuild,v 1.3 2000/11/20 16:47:18 drobbins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-kernel/linux-sources/linux-sources-2.4.0_rc10-r1.ebuild,v 1.1 2000/11/22 21:25:18 drobbins Exp $
A="linux-2.4.0-test8.tar.bz2 linux-2.4.0-test9-reiserfs-3.6.18-patch.gz
patch-2.4.0-test9.bz2 patch-2.4.0-test10.bz2
@@ -65,6 +65,13 @@ src_unpack() {
unpack alsa-driver-0.5.9d.tar.bz2
echo "Unpacking NVidia drivers..."
unpack NVIDIA_kernel-0.9-5.tar.gz
+ cd NVIDIA_kernel-0.9-5
+ # this is a little fix to make the NVidia drivers compile right with test10
+ mv nv.c nv.c.orig
+ echo '#define mem_map_inc_count(p) atomic_inc(&(p->count))' > nv.c
+ echo '#define mem_map_dec_count(p) atomic_dec(&(p->count))' >> nv.c
+ cat nv.c.orig >> nv.c
+ cd ${S}/extras
for x in lm_sensors i2c
do
echo "Unpacking and applying $x patch..."
@@ -78,8 +85,8 @@ src_unpack() {
echo "Preparing for compilation..."
cd ${S}
#this is the configuration for the bootdisk/cd
- cp ${FILESDIR}/${P}.config .config
- cp ${FILESDIR}/${P}.autoconf include/linux/autoconf.h
+ cp ${FILESDIR}/${PV}/${P}.config .config
+ cp ${FILESDIR}/${PV}/${P}.autoconf include/linux/autoconf.h
try make include/linux/version.h
try make symlinks
try make dep
diff --git a/sys-kernel/linux/files/linux-2.4.10_rc10.autoconf b/sys-kernel/linux/files/2.4.0_rc10/linux-2.4.0_rc10.autoconf
index a93b70337b72..a93b70337b72 100644
--- a/sys-kernel/linux/files/linux-2.4.10_rc10.autoconf
+++ b/sys-kernel/linux/files/2.4.0_rc10/linux-2.4.0_rc10.autoconf
diff --git a/sys-kernel/linux/files/linux-2.4.10_rc10.config b/sys-kernel/linux/files/2.4.0_rc10/linux-2.4.0_rc10.config
index f4fbf51382c8..f4fbf51382c8 100644
--- a/sys-kernel/linux/files/linux-2.4.10_rc10.config
+++ b/sys-kernel/linux/files/2.4.0_rc10/linux-2.4.0_rc10.config
diff --git a/sys-kernel/linux/files/digest-linux-2.4.10_rc10 b/sys-kernel/linux/files/digest-linux-2.4.10_rc10
deleted file mode 100644
index 0ada5ec263a1..000000000000
--- a/sys-kernel/linux/files/digest-linux-2.4.10_rc10
+++ /dev/null
@@ -1,9 +0,0 @@
-MD5 8f281617879cf79c44561fb8fb90caec linux-2.4.0-test8.tar.bz2
-MD5 33f1208d6b07e42937de92b0be14fc99 linux-2.4.0-test9-reiserfs-3.6.18-patch.gz
-MD5 3878cd9f9f9e45bddb625dd4059e7e32 patch-2.4.0-test9.bz2
-MD5 3fb3759c30a51bf230a231815413d433 patch-2.4.0-test10.bz2
-MD5 039fb223e361d343e8d40c54f0a317e6 i2c-2.5.4.tar.gz
-MD5 c16f3df6b5f9e56b146071edfa5ec5d4 lm_sensors-2.5.4.tar.gz
-MD5 b2cf95e1189e63b44e6f7ae7fc27ae19 jfs-0.0.18-patch.tar.gz
-MD5 5d4983ad745464954aa770196167ad06 alsa-driver-0.5.9d.tar.bz2
-MD5 130d1e7bf56eda1a93a831189b4c6420 NVIDIA_kernel-0.9-5.tar.gz
diff --git a/sys-kernel/linux/linux-2.4.10_rc10.ebuild b/sys-kernel/linux/linux-2.4.0_rc10-r1.ebuild
index fa01c6e2cafb..b51c3316a8e0 100644
--- a/sys-kernel/linux/linux-2.4.10_rc10.ebuild
+++ b/sys-kernel/linux/linux-2.4.0_rc10-r1.ebuild
@@ -1,7 +1,7 @@
# Copyright 1999-2000 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License, v2 or later
# Author Daniel Robbins <drobbins@gentoo.org>
-# $Header: /var/cvsroot/gentoo-x86/sys-kernel/linux/linux-2.4.10_rc10.ebuild,v 1.1 2000/11/20 16:47:18 drobbins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-kernel/linux/linux-2.4.0_rc10-r1.ebuild,v 1.1 2000/11/22 21:25:18 drobbins Exp $
A="linux-2.4.0-test8.tar.bz2 linux-2.4.0-test9-reiserfs-3.6.18-patch.gz
patch-2.4.0-test9.bz2 patch-2.4.0-test10.bz2
@@ -65,6 +65,13 @@ src_unpack() {
unpack alsa-driver-0.5.9d.tar.bz2
echo "Unpacking NVidia drivers..."
unpack NVIDIA_kernel-0.9-5.tar.gz
+ cd NVIDIA_kernel-0.9-5
+ # this is a little fix to make the NVidia drivers compile right with test10
+ mv nv.c nv.c.orig
+ echo '#define mem_map_inc_count(p) atomic_inc(&(p->count))' > nv.c
+ echo '#define mem_map_dec_count(p) atomic_dec(&(p->count))' >> nv.c
+ cat nv.c.orig >> nv.c
+ cd ${S}/extras
for x in lm_sensors i2c
do
echo "Unpacking and applying $x patch..."
@@ -78,8 +85,8 @@ src_unpack() {
echo "Preparing for compilation..."
cd ${S}
#this is the configuration for the bootdisk/cd
- cp ${FILESDIR}/${P}.config .config
- cp ${FILESDIR}/${P}.autoconf include/linux/autoconf.h
+ cp ${FILESDIR}/${PV}/${P}.config .config
+ cp ${FILESDIR}/${PV}/${P}.autoconf include/linux/autoconf.h
try make include/linux/version.h
try make symlinks
try make dep